"This particular lesson is about how the period of “breakdown” is the process of literally breaking down your old identity, thoughts, habits, and actions with grace. Not gracefully, perfectly, and beautifully, but allowing yourself grace. Otherwise, you’ll have new thoughts that can sneak up on you and flip your shit with the quickest onset of impostor syndrome you’ve ever felt. Who am I kidding, that will happen anyway, but the grace part sounds good doesn't it? As people begin to notice your change, sure, they might judge you. Okay, I’m on a roll here, they will totally judge you, and you’ll most certainly dip a toe into the worst-self-critic-pool yourself and if you’re not mindful you might completely fall in."
